Porlock village centre is within approximately half a mile and has an excellent range of everyday facilities to include church, village hall, primary school, bowling club, health centre, shops, inns and restaurants. The quaint hamlet and harbour of Porlock Weir is approximately one and a half miles and West Somerset’s coastal resort of Minehead which has a more comprehensive shopping facility is approximately six miles. The county town of Taunton which has mainline rail connections and access to the motorway network is approximately twenty eight miles and for those who enjoy exploring the countryside Exmoor is literally on the doorstep with superb walks nearby, the coast is within a mile and the Quantock and Brendon Hills and the many renowned beauty spots of the area are all close at hand.
